Popular Styles of Cut In Eyebrow

Popular Styles Of Cut In Eyebrow

There are many different styles of cut in eyebrow, each with its own unique meaning and look. Here are some of the most popular:

  • Straight cut: This is the most common style of cut in eyebrow. It involves a straight line shaved into the eyebrow, usually in the middle or towards the end. It can convey a sense of confidence and edginess.
  • Slanted cut: This style involves a slanted line cut into the eyebrow, usually towards the end. It can give the face a more angular and defined look.
  • Zigzag cut: This style involves a zigzag pattern cut into the eyebrow. It is often seen as a more daring and unconventional style.
  • Double cut: This style involves two parallel lines cut into the eyebrow. It can give the face a more symmetrical and balanced look.

Is Cut In Eyebrow Safe?

Is Cut In Eyebrow Safe

While cut in eyebrow may be a popular trend, it is important to consider the safety implications before attempting it. Shaving or cutting the eyebrow can lead to infection, scarring, and even permanent hair loss. It is recommended to seek the help of a professional stylist or barber who has experience in creating cut in eyebrow.
